FG Threatens to Disconnect Power Companies Over Grid Stability Breach

The Federal Government has warned electricity generation companies that they risk disconnection from the national grid if they fail to comply with new rules on power stability.

The Nigerian Electricity Regulatory Commission (NERC), says all generating units must activate the Free Governor Control system, which automatically balances power output to keep the grid stable.

The commission explained that non-compliant companies will face a 10 per cent penalty on their invoices, and any generating unit that defaults for 90 consecutive days will be cut off.

NERC says the order, which takes effect September 1, is aimed at preventing frequent system collapses and ensuring more reliable power supply across the country.
